Summary Two patients who had obstructed labour due to a presacral tumour are reported. Both tumours were diagnosed in the second stage of labour. In one patient delivery was accomplished with Barton's forceps. The other patient required a Caesarean section. The tumours were excised at a later date. One was an epidermoid cyst and the other was thought to be a malignant haemangioendothelioma.
